Ordinals
beta
Address 1FwiDj8EYV8eDWwB2iavLCcudpqRqBjKG8
sat balance
118546
runes balances
outputs
f90e3f65eb271b0e704a5f575be2b0600dc69c04838d4d7d68117baf98f493d3:6